简答题

为何T1用作串行口波特率发生器时常用模式2?若fosc=6MHz,试求出T1在模式2下可能产生的波特率的变化范围。

正确答案

定时器T1作为波特率发生器可工作于模式0、模式1和模式2。其中模式2在T1溢出后可自动装入时间常数,避免了重装参数,因而在实际应用中除非波特率很低,一般都采用模式2。若fosc=6MHz,T1在模式2下可能产生的波特率的变化范围为:61.04bps~15625bps。

答案解析

相似试题
  • 串行口方式1的波特率是可变的,通过定时器/计数器T1的溢出设定。

    判断题查看答案

  • 8031利用串行口通信时,设波特率为2400bit/s,晶振频率为11.0592MHz,T1选方式2,SMOD=0,则T1的重新装入值为()。

    单选题查看答案

  • 试利用增强型MCS-51串行口自动地址识别功能构造“一主八从”多机通信系统。假设只需要“一对一”的通信方式,请写出串行口的初始化程序段(系统晶振频率为11.0592 MHz,波特率为2400,使用定时器T1的溢出率作为通信波特率)。

    简答题查看答案

  • 波特率的含义是(),MCS-51的串行口有()种工作模式。

    填空题查看答案

  • 80C51的()作为串行口方式1和方式3的波特率发生器。

    填空题查看答案

  • 串行口工作方式3的波特率是()

    单选题查看答案

  • 串行口工作方式1的波特率是()。

    单选题查看答案

  • 串行口工作于方式0的波特率是可变的。

    判断题查看答案

  • MCS-51串行口通信波特率固定的要工作在()。

    单选题查看答案